IBM's Theseus is a memory analysis program for the OS/2 system. It is used for:

  • Determine the amount of memory consumed by each process.
  • Determine working set information on a system basis or per process.
  • Detect memory leaks on a system-wide basis or per process.
  • Examine application memory (in hexadecimal notation)
  • Examine selected OS/2 system control blocks (formatted)
  • Examine selected machine registers and control blocks (formatted)
